Junk removal services involve the collection, hauling, and proper disposal of unwanted items from residential properties. Whether clearing out clutter, removing large debris, or disposing of old furniture, these services help homeowners manage messes efficiently. Service providers typically handle a wide range of materials, including household trash, appliances, yard waste, and renovation debris, making it easier to maintain a clean and organized living space.

The overview below groups typical Junk Removal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Junk Removal - Typical costs for small-scale junk removal jobs range from $150 to $400. Many routine projects, such as clearing out a garage or basement, fall within this range. Larger or more complex small jobs may approach $500 or more.

Medium-Sized Cleanouts - For larger cleanouts like estate or office spaces, costs generally fall between $500 and $1,500. Most projects of this size are completed within this range, though extensive or cluttered spaces can push costs higher.

Heavy Debris Removal - Removing construction debris, appliances, or large furniture typ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Many projects in this category are in the middle of this range, with very large or difficult items increasing the price.

Full Property Clearouts - Complete property or large-scale estate cleanouts can range from $3,000 to over $5,000. While most jobs are in the lower part of this spectrum, highly complex or extensive projects can reach higher cost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local contractors for junk removal services,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of handling junk removal jobs comparable in size and scope to their own needs. An experienced contractor is likely to understand the best practices for efficient and safe removal, which can help ensure the process goes smoothly. Gathering information about how long a contractor has been operating and the types of projects they have completed can provide valuable insight into their familiarity with the work.

Clear written expectations are essential when evaluating local service providers. Homeowners should seek out contractors who can provide detailed descriptions of their services, including what is included and any potential limitations. Having a transparent understanding of what to expect hel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the scope of work. It’s also beneficial to confirm that the contractor is willing to communicate openly about their process, pricing, and any specific requirements related to the junk removal project.

Reputable references and good communication are key factors in choosing the right local pros. Homeowners can ask potential service providers for references from previous clients to gain insights into their reliability, professionalism, and quality of work. Additionally, clear and prompt communication from the contractor can indicate their level of customer service and attentiveness. What types of junk removal services are available? Local service providers typically handle a variety of junk removal tasks, including appliance disposal, furniture removal, construction debris cleanup, yard waste, and general clutter removal.

How do I prepare for a junk removal service? Customers should clear pathways to the items, specify any fragile or hazardous materials, and ensure that items are accessible for pickup by the service provider.

Are there any items that junk removal services cannot handle? Some providers may not accept hazardous materials, chemicals, or certain large or delicate items. It’s best to check with local contractors about specific restrictions.
